**Mgmt Meeting Minutes — Retiring the Brightline Range**

Quick recap for sales leads at Fenholt Supplies: we agreed to retire the Brightline fixture range by year-end. Remaining stock moves to clearance pricing next month, and accounts on standing orders get migrated to the Lumetta range. Trade-in incentives were approved in principle. The confidential note on next steps sits just below.

board note of bajof-bajeg: The pricing group signed off on a budget of $13.4 million for Project Sildor. The renewal with Lamixek Holdings closes at $48.9 million a year, 49 percent above the last contract.

Subject: Relevance cut-over done

Hi Mara,

The Quillfind relevance cut-over wrapped up last night. New synonym weights and the recency boost are live on both clusters, and click-through on the staging sample looked healthy. Old tuning profile is archived in case we need a fast revert. One heads-up: the typo-tolerance threshold changed more than planned, so watch support tickets this week. The active tuning values now in production are listed below.

service settings:
druael:
  log_level: error
  metrics_host: metrics.druael.tolvaqlabs.internal
  pool_size: 16

The garage occupancy feed for the Brindlewood campus arrives over a message queue every thirty seconds, one record per level, published by the Stallgrid edge boxes. Counts can briefly go negative when a sensor double-fires on exit; the ingest job clamps these to zero and flags the interval. If the feed stalls for more than five minutes, the dashboard falls back to the last known snapshot. Sensor mappings, queue names, and the replay procedure are documented on the internal page below.

runbook for tahog-kadug: https://gitlab.qirvanworks.corp/projects/pages/view/b139298aed28